Author Information

David Bedford has written over 85 children's books in a best-selling career that spans 20 years. David's books are known for their warmth and humour, whether in classic bedtime tales about bears, more boisterous and brightly illustrated books about dinosaurs, or his long-standing fiction series about a football (soccer) team and their adoring fans Professor Gertie, and her greatest invention, the lovable robot Mark 1. David enjoys nothing more than visiting schools to promote reading, tell great stories, coach writing, and share what he knows about being a creative person.
